- Arts-and-crafts foundation founded in 2025 by Dries Van Noten and Patrick Vangheluwe, seated at Palazzo Pisani Moretta on Venice's Grand Canal. Debut exhibition "The Only True Protest is Beauty" opened April 2026 (curated by Geert Bruloot, runs to 4 October 2026); included 14 Comme des Garcons designs, Christian Lacroix haute couture, sculptures by Peter Buggenhout, Lionel Jadot, Lilla Tabasso, a Joseph Arzoumanov chess set, plus works by Steven Shearer and Ettore Sottsass.
